Rescued Red-tailed hawk

By Sarvey Wildlife / Monday, March 26, 2018 /
featured_image

On March 16th, we got a call about this poor Red-tailed hawk. She was found hanging trapped in barbed wire, by her neck. Our Clinic Manager, Jessie, went to rescue her. The hawk was really lucky as the wounds were superficial and she was mainly just tangled up by her feathers. Her recovery was quick and we were able to release her this week.
